#ifndef SERIALIS_H
#define SERIALIS_H
#include <stdlib.h>
#include <string.h>
#include <stdio.h>
#include "memry.h"
#include "errcode.h"
#include "fileerr.h"
/* **************************************************************************
These are the only routines that write/read data to/from the serialisation.
"serialise_bytes" and "de_serialise_bytes" are used to serialise NON class
items. The "make_serialise" macro generates "serialise" and "de_serialise"
member functions for the class name specified in the macro parameter.
************************************************************************** */
extern DLLSYM void *de_serialise_bytes(FILE *f, int size);
extern DLLSYM void serialise_bytes(FILE *f, void *ptr, int size);
extern DLLSYM void serialise_INT32(FILE *f, inT32 the_int);
extern DLLSYM inT32 de_serialise_INT32(FILE *f);
extern DLLSYM void serialise_FLOAT64(FILE *f, double the_float);
extern DLLSYM double de_serialise_FLOAT64(FILE *f);
// Switch endinan.
extern DLLSYM uinT64 reverse64(uinT64);
extern DLLSYM uinT32 reverse32(uinT32);
extern DLLSYM uinT16 reverse16(uinT16);
/***********************************************************************
QUOTE_IT MACRO DEFINITION
===========================
Replace <parm> with "<parm>". <parm> may be an arbitrary number of tokens
***********************************************************************/
#define QUOTE_IT( parm ) #parm
